About Company:
Our client is a Palo Alto–based AI infrastructure and talent platform founded in 2018. It helps companies connect with remote software developers using AI-powered vetting and matching technology. Originally branded as the “Intelligent Talent Cloud, "enabled companies to “spin up their engineering dream team in the cloud” by sourcing and managing vetted global talent.
In recent years, they have evolved to support AI infrastructure and AGI workflows, offering services in model training, fine-tuning, and deployment—powered by their internal AI platform, ALAN, and backed by a vast talent network. They reported $300 million in revenue and reached profitability. Their growth is driven by demand for annotated training data from AI labs, including major clients like OpenAI, Google, Anthropic, and Meta.

Job Title: Movement & Physical Activity Annotator
Location: Pan India
Experience: 3+ yrs.
Employment Type: Contract to hire
Work Mode: Remote
Notice Period: - Immediate joiners
Roles & Responsibilities:
Role Overview:
We are seeking experienced Movement & Physical Activity Experts to help evaluate and enhance large language model (LLM) outputs related to human movement, physical activity, and exercise science. You’ll assess AI-generated content for scientific accuracy, safety, and relevance — contributing to the development of responsible AI in health and fitness. Selected talents will review and label data related to physical activity, exercise, and movement patterns (e.g., wearable sensor data, activity logs, video, or text) to support the training and evaluation of AI/health models.
What You'll Do Day-to-Day:
- Annotate activity type, intensity, duration, and movement quality from raw data sources (sensor streams, logs, video, or transcripts).
- Apply standardized taxonomies (e.g., MET values, exercise categories, gait/posture labels) consistently across datasets.
- Flag ambiguous, incomplete, or low-quality data for review.
- Identify inconsistencies between self-reported activity and objective data signals.
- Collaborate with domain experts to refine annotation guidelines and edge-case handling.
- Meet accuracy and throughput targets while maintaining inter-annotator agreement.
Requirements
- Background in exercise science, kinesiology, physical therapy, sports science, or related field.
- Familiarity with physical activity classification systems and wearable/sensor data.
- Robust attention to detail and ability to follow detailed labeling guidelines.
- Comfort working with spreadsheets, annotation tools, or labeling platforms.
- Ideal to have a MacBook.
Preferred Qualifications:
- Prior data annotation or labeling experience, especially in health/fitness domains.
- Experience with wearable device data (e.g., accelerometer, heart rate, GPS).
- Basic understanding of AI/ML data pipelines.
- Primary: Certified Personal Trainer (CPT) from a recognized organization (e.g., ACE, NASM, ACSM, NSCA), Exercise Physiologist (EP-C, ACSM), or Kinesiologist.
- Secondary (Bonus): Physical Therapist (PT/DPT), Sports Scientist, or a related degree in Exercise Science/Kinesiology.
- Experience: Minimum 2-3 years of practical experience coaching individuals or groups in fitness, rehabilitation, or sports performance.
